Выдает ошибку... Срочно помогите

Аватар пользователя SnowUfa SnowUfa 18 июля 2008 в 0:46

После того как установил русификатор, вроде проблем не было до 2шага:
Requirements problem
The following error must be resolved before you can continue the installation process:
The Drupal installer requires that you create ./sites/default/settings.php as part of the installation process, and then make it writable. If you are unsure how to grant file permissions, please consult the on-line handbook.
The following installation warning should be carefully reviewed:
Operations on Unicode strings are emulated on a best-effort basis. Install the PHP mbstring extension for improved Unicode support. (Currently using Unicode library Standard PHP)

Please check the error messages and try again.

ЧТо это ?! ПОмогите разобраться!

Комментарии

Аватар пользователя Nikit Nikit 18 июля 2008 в 2:20

1. друпал не достучался до ./sites/default/settings.php - и это ошибка.
2. сча работает эмулятором строк, рекомендует (или предупреждает) установить модуль mbstring для php - и это не ошибка.

Аватар пользователя inquis@drupal.org inquis@drupal.org 18 июля 2008 в 12:29

Уже обсуждалось пару раз. В друпал 6.3 необходимо самому ручками копировать/переименовать файл /sites/default/default.settings.php в /sites/default/settings.php.
Сам друпал создавать этот файл не будет.

Аватар пользователя SnowUfa SnowUfa 18 июля 2008 в 13:58

Cделал, теперь выдает эту ошибку:
Warning: fopen(./sites/default/default.settings.php) [function.fopen]: failed to open stream: No such file or directory in Z:\home\localhost\www\drupal\includes\install.inc on line 187

Warning: Cannot modify header information - headers already sent by (output started at Z:\home\localhost\www\drupal\includes\install.inc:187) in Z:\home\localhost\www\drupal\includes\install.inc on line 617

Warning: Cannot modify header information - headers already sent by (output started at Z:\home\localhost\www\drupal\includes\install.inc:187) in Z:\home\localhost\www\drupal\includes\install.inc on line 618

Аватар пользователя gumk gumk 18 июля 2008 в 14:10

Должен быть и файл дефаултсетлингс и сетлингс (пишу с телефона в лом на английский переключать)

Аватар пользователя olk olk 18 июля 2008 в 14:26

В изначальной поставке default.setting.php находиться в sites/default/defult.setting.php,
если друпал не может создать setting.php то возможно не правильно настроены права на дерево сервера (где то я это описывал),
простейшее решение скопировать default.setting.php в setting.php и назначить ему доступ 777 ...
но правильней сконфигурировать прав доступа и проставить овнера и овнера группы на все дерево вашего сервера

Аватар пользователя SnowUfa SnowUfa 18 июля 2008 в 14:31

Operations on Unicode strings are emulated on a best-effort basis. Install the PHP mbstring extension for improved Unicode support. (Currently using Unicode library Standard PHP) - это что?

Аватар пользователя SnowUfa SnowUfa 18 июля 2008 в 14:41

А права где ставить? и еще вот может лучше сделать так - сначала установить дрюпал на английском, а потом перевести на русский? так вообще возможно сделать?

Аватар пользователя olk olk 18 июля 2008 в 15:38

скопировать default.setting.php в setting.php
unix: cp default.setting.php setting.php
windows: copy default.setting.php setting.php
PHP mbstring extension - посит вас установить расширение mbstring для php (в принципе и без него работать будет, друпал будет эмулировть функции mbstring)
По правам если у вас unix(linux) то man chmod, man chown
если локальный виндуз то забейте Smile
по локализации - ответ ДА.

Аватар пользователя SnowUfa SnowUfa 19 июля 2008 в 22:38

все спасибо, понял.... А еще вопрос не в тему, но мне интересен, насколько сложен сайт в изучении в отличии от Джумла или других цмсок... Чем он хорош/плох, спасибо:)

Аватар пользователя kiev1 kiev1 22 июля 2008 в 3:01

это битая инсталяха - все перепутали, конечно если скопировать один в другой - то работает, но что это - очередной тест на "порог вхождения"
насчет в сравнении с Джумлой - то это как сравнивать винду и линукс - примерно так...